Techniques Used By Practitioners
Practitioners use light hand placements on or near the horse. They avoid sudden movements to keep the horse calm. Some use long strokes along the horse’s body. Others focus on specific areas with tension or pain. The touch is always soft and respectful. The techniques encourage the horse’s own healing power.
Session Environment And Duration
Sessions usually happen in quiet, familiar places for the horse. This setting helps the animal feel safe and relaxed. The session length varies but often lasts about 20 to 40 minutes. Practitioners observe the horse’s reactions to guide the time. A calm environment supports deeper energy healing and trust.

Behavioral Changes
Your horse may become calmer during and after Reiki. They might stand quietly or close their eyes. Some horses show trust by lowering their head. Others may nuzzle or seek gentle touch. Less restlessness or anxiety also shows Reiki is working.
Physical Reactions
Physical signs include deep, slow breathing. Your horse may yawn or stretch more often. Some horses shake off tension or lick their lips. Muscle relaxation and softer eyes are good signs too. These reactions show energy is flowing smoothly.

Qualifications To Look For
Check if the practitioner has formal Reiki training and certification. Experience with horses is a big plus. They should know horse behavior and body language well. Ask about their background in both Reiki and working with animals. This ensures they use safe and effective techniques.
Questions To Ask Before Sessions
Ask how they work with horses during Reiki sessions. Find out what methods they use and how long each session lasts. Inquire about their approach to handling nervous or shy horses. Clarify any safety measures they take for your horse’s health. Make sure you feel comfortable with their answers and style.
